How much does a Desktop Publisher III make in the United States? The average Desktop Publisher III salary in the United States is $67,890 as of February 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$58,580 and $78,840.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Desktop Publisher III Salaries by Percentile
Percentile Salary Location Last Updated
10th Percentile Desktop Publisher III Salary $50,104 US February 26, 2024
25th Percentile Desktop Publisher III Salary $58,580 US February 26, 2024
50th Percentile Desktop Publisher III Salary $67,890 US February 26, 2024
75th Percentile Desktop Publisher III Salary $78,840 US February 26, 2024
90th Percentile Desktop Publisher III Salary $88,809 US February 26, 2024

Job Description

The Desktop Publisher III designs page layouts, charts, graphs, and computer graphics. Utilizes desktop publishing tools, equipment, and software packages to create and produce a variety of high quality communication materials that incorporate text and graphic images. Being a Desktop Publisher III may require an associate's degree. Selects, imports, and edits graphic images used to enhance the impact of the materials. In addition, Desktop Publisher III typ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Being a Desktop Publisher III has gained full proficiency in a broad range of activities related to the job. Independently performs a wide range of complex duties under general guidance from supervisors. Working as a Desktop Publisher III typically requires 5-7 years of related experience. These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Desktop Publisher III in the United States. The base salary for Desktop Publisher III ranges from $58,580 to $78,840 with the average base salary of $67,890.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$60,050 to $82,410 with the average total cash compensation of $69,620.
